Man Utd send scouts to watch superstar who will transform their attack
Sportbible.com and 1 more
- Manchester United has stepped up scouting for Rafael Leao, with club spotters watching him in Serie A as they bid to accelerate a potential transfer this summer.
- Leao is regarded as a marquee attacking option for United, given his standout Serie A form and versatility to play left wing or centrally.
- Reports suggest a bid around £52 million could tempt Milan to sell Leao, given two years remaining on his contract.
- Goal notes Leao has two years left on his Milan contract, with Milan potentially open to selling if valuation is met.
- Romano confirms Premier League clubs have begun inquiries, signaling growing interest ahead of any potential negotiations.
- Interest is not limited to Italy; Barcelona and Saudi clubs are among those weighing a move for Leao, complicating United’s path to a deal.
